The Essentials
Initial 12-week freelance contract - potential to become permanent
£20 per hour
10 hours per week
Work flexibly from home - ideally meeting and working together in Brighton occasionally. Starting ASAP.
Closing date - 26th September, although we will assess applications as they come in and may close applications sooner than this.
About us
Party Snail Games is a small independent board game company making fast, funny party games - including Ninja Hamster Apocalypse Disco, Clay It Again and What The Scribble?! We’ve sold more than 25,000 games since launching 2 years ago and are now looking to grow our social presence to share our games and brand.
About the role
We’re looking for someone creative, organised and commercially minded to help us grow on TikTok and Instagram.
You’ll help us:
- Edit engaging, primarily video-based content (we expect this will form at least half the role)
- Help plan and develop content ideas
- Create content yourself where appropriate - we expect this to mostly be video
- Post regularly and interact through our social accounts
- Grow our audience and help us sell through TikTok Shop and other channels
- Use AI and automation behind the scenes to build efficient, repeatable processes for planning, editing and scheduling - but not to generate content or interact with our audience!

About you
You will:
- Be a skilled video editor, with experience turning raw footage into engaging short-form content
- Have experience creating video content for social media. This doesn't have to be in a professional capacity and could be for yourself, a brand or somebody else.
- Understand TikTok, Instagram and what makes content work
- Think about the why, not just make things look polished
- Balance quality with getting content made and published
- Be reliable, organised and a good communicator
- Be comfortable giving and receiving honest feedback
- Live in the UK and have a legal right to work here
You don’t need professional experience, and you don’t necessarily need to appear on camera - although it's a positive if you can. However, some hands-on experience of creating and editing online content (either for yourself or others) is essential. We care most about your instincts, ideas, attitude and ability to make things happen.

An interest in marketing and e-commerce would be a big bonus.
We’re based in Brighton, so being within travelling distance - whether in Sussex, London or elsewhere in the Southeast - would be a bonus, but it isn’t essential.
And a bit more info
You’ll work closely with the founder and our small team, see lots of different parts of a growing business and have a genuine opportunity to shape how our brand develops. We’re a friendly, supportive team, and you’ll also be eligible for a performance bonus so you can share in the success you help create.
We know we’re asking for a varied mix of skills, so we’ll shape the role around the strengths of the right person. You won’t be expected to arrive being amazing at everything - we’re looking for someone who can take ownership, learn quickly and develop with us.
If the role and the business both develop as we hope, there’s also the potential for this to become a permanent position.
